countly-bulk-user.js

/**
 * CountlyBulkUser object to make it easier to send information about specific user in bulk requests
 * @name CountlyBulkUser
 * @module lib/countly-bulk-user
 * @example
 * var CountlyBulk = require("countly-sdk-nodejs").Bulk;
 *
 * var server = new CountlyBulk({
 *   app_key: "{YOUR-API-KEY}",
 *   url: "https://API_HOST/",
 *   debug: true
 * });

 * //adding requests by user
 * var user = server.add_user({device_id:"my_device_id"});
 */
var cc = require("./countly-common");
/**
 * @lends module:lib/countly-bulk-user
 * Initialize CountlyBulkUser object
 * @param {Object} conf - CountlyBulkUser configuration options
 * @param {Object} conf.server - CountlyBulk instance with server configuration
 * @param {string} conf.device_id - identification of the user
 * @param {string=} conf.country_code - country code for your user
 * @param {string=} conf.city - name of the city of your user
 * @param {string=} conf.ip_address - ip address of your user
 * @param {boolean} [conf.debug=false] - output debug info into console
 * @param {boolean} [conf.require_consent=false] - Pass true if you are implementing GDPR compatible consent management. It would prevent running any functionality without proper consent
 * @param {number} [conf.max_key_length=128] - maximum size of all string keys
 * @param {number} [conf.max_value_size=256] - maximum size of all values in our key-value pairs (Except "picture" field, that has a limit of 4096 chars)
 * @param {number} [conf.max_segmentation_values=30] - max amount of custom (dev provided) segmentation in one event
 * @param {number} [conf.max_breadcrumb_count=100] - maximum amount of breadcrumbs that can be recorded before the oldest one is deleted
 * @param {number} [conf.max_stack_trace_lines_per_thread=30] - maximum amount of stack trace lines would be recorded per thread
 * @param {number} [conf.max_stack_trace_line_length=200] - maximum amount of characters are allowed per stack trace line. This limits also the crash message length
 * @example
 * var CountlyBulk = require("countly-sdk-nodejs").Bulk;
 *
 * var server = new CountlyBulk({
 *   app_key: "{YOUR-API-KEY}",
 *   url: "https://API_HOST/",
 *   debug: true
 * });
 *
 * //adding requests by user
 * var user = server.add_user({device_id:"my_device_id"});
 * user.begin_session().add_event({key:"Test", count:1})
 */

    /**
    * Start user's sesssion
    * @param {Object} metrics - provide {@link Metrics} for this user/device, or else will try to collect what's possible
    * @param {string} metrics._os - name of platform/operating system
    * @param {string} metrics._os_version - version of platform/operating system
    * @param {string=} metrics._device - device name
    * @param {string=} metrics._resolution - screen resolution of the device
    * @param {string=} metrics._carrier - carrier or operator used for connection
    * @param {string=} metrics._density - screen density of the device
    * @param {string=} metrics._locale - locale or language of the device in ISO format
    * @param {string=} metrics._store - source from where the user/device/installation came from
    * @param {number} seconds - how long did the session last in seconds
    * @param {number} timestamp - timestamp when session started
    * @returns {module:lib/countly-bulk-user} instance
    * */
    this.begin_session = function(metrics, seconds, timestamp) {
        if (this.check_consent("sessions")) {
            var bulk = [];
            var query = prepareQuery({ begin_session: 1, metrics });
            if (this.check_consent("location")) {
                if (conf.country_code) {
                    query.country_code = conf.country_code;
                }
                if (conf.city) {
                    query.city = conf.city;
                }
            }
            else {
                query.location = "";
            }
            if (timestamp) {
                sessionStart = timestamp;
                query.timestamp = timestamp;
            }
            bulk.push(query);

            seconds = parseInt(seconds || 0);

            var beatCount = Math.ceil(seconds / 60);
            for (var i = 0; i < beatCount; i++) {
                if (seconds > 0) {
                    query = prepareQuery();
                    if (seconds > 60) {
                        query.session_duration = 60;
                    }
                    else {
                        query.session_duration = seconds;
                    }
                    if (conf.ip_address) {
                        query.ip_address = conf.ip_address;
                    }
                    if (timestamp) {
                        query.timestamp = timestamp + ((i + 1) * 60);
                    }
                    seconds -= 60;
                    bulk.push(query);
                }
            }
            conf.server.add_bulk_request(bulk);
        }
        else {
            lastParams.begin_session = arguments;
        }
        return this;
    };
